Inman, Archie and Tellez rein as 2025 Wellington queens

WELLINGTON – Anticipation filled the air as the Wellington High School (WHS) Booster Scholarship Fund organizers presented the 2025 Teen Miss, Junior Miss and Little Miss Wellington pageants at 2 p.m. Sunday afternoon, April 6 at the WHS auditorium.

Special Easter services planned in Wellington

WELLINGTON – Collingsworth County Ministerial Alliance (CCMA) invites area residents to join in the annual Community Easter Service set for 6 p.m. Sunday, April 13 at Trinity Fellowship, 1305 Ft. Worth St.First Christian Church Pastor Will Grant will bring the Easter message of hope.

The annual Community-Wide Easter Egg Hunt, hosted by the Childress County 4-H Club, will take place at 5:30 p.m. Tuesday, April 15 at the Fair Park Pavillion in Childress. Children ages one-year-old through second grade are invited to participate. Prizes will be provided by local businesses. Courtesy Graphic

At the Childress Municipal Airport

CHILDRESS — Wednesday, April 2, a Pilatus PC-12 flew in from Addison to drop off passengers and then stayed overnight. An MD900 helicopter and a Swearingen Merlin stopped for fuel on their way south.
